FERNEL, Jean François. De naturali parte medicinae libri septem. Lyons: Jean de Tournes and Guil. Gazeius, 1551.
16o (112 x 72 mm). Contemporary blind-stamped pigskin over bevelled wooden boards, sides panelled with fillets and rosette tools, two brass clasps and catchplates. Provenance: Buxheim, Charterhouse (ink ownership inscription on title, shelfmark G.42 on spine label); Bibliothek Buxheim (ink library stamp on A2r).
Third edition, very fine in its contemporary binding for the Charterhouse of Buxheim. All early editions of Fernel's physiology are scarce. The first appeared in folio from Simon de Colines in 1542. NLM/Durling 1481.
